Just a glorious day for paddling on Easter morning! While others may have been at Easter Services or Easter brunch, it seemed that I had the whole ocean to myself. It was totally calm and glassy and the water is clearing up nicely. Down by the boat ramp, the water was crystal clear and I enjoyed looking at the rocks and coral. Suddenly I realized that one of those rocks was a turtle! I watched as it vigorously chomped at something on one of the rocks, it must have been a pretty tasty treat! After doing some meditating in the quiet zone, I headed back. What a great day to be out on the ocean! Then, while I was getting ready to wash down my board, I was chatting with a paddling friend, and she told me to look out. On my board was a BIG praying mantis! It had crawled out from a near by bush onto my board and it was busy investigating my board by climbing all over the leash. It was so funny to encounter a praying mantis for Easter!
